Saturn didn't sell well since fans and stores were ticked at sega for bad marketing with the clutter of consoles and add-ons. Certain stores made pacts to refuse sales of saturns because of it. Not only that, saturn was released 6 months early or something without warning and this was not very good marketing in the north americas. However, Sega played all it's cards right and saturn was a hit in japan. Great marketing there. People liked the advertisements and bought saturns as a result. Not only that, people actually played the console there and their friends played it and they loved it for the console it was. Most of the great saturn games were japan exclusives for this reason and japan also got many different versions of the console and all that good stuff. Saturn also had some of the greatest RPGS and Fighters ever. Learn your facts please and actually play a decent chunk of the saturn library before you make assumptions please. I don't think we need a dreamcast history check really, but it was actually not so much bad marketing this time as it was that P.O.S PS2 selling a DVD player in its console marketing it as the worlds cheapewst DVD player. Makes me wonder how Dreamcast would have done with a DVD player. Dreamcast was also epicly revolutionary for it being the first online gaming console.
